Arkaroola is a private wilderness area preserved and run by the Sprigg family since the late 1960s. This is due to the vision of Reg Sprigg, one of Australia's greatest geologists. As a result of the Spriggs' efforts anyone can now visit and appreciate this fantastic wilderness area. It reminded me of Yosemite, one of the world's great national parks.... More

Arkaroola offers a great "outback" experience in the northern Flinders Ranges (known as the Gammon Ranges) in South Australia, Australia's driest state. It is an isolated and magnificant setting - accessible by dirt road with the nearest towns of any size about two hours' drive. The night sky is full of stars.
